    What is a fix and flip loan?

    A fix and flip loan is a short-term real estate loan secured by the investment property itself. It covers two costs in a single structure: the acquisition price and the full rehabilitation budget. When the rehab is complete and the property sells, the loan is repaid.

    Fix and flip loans are built for active real estate investors, not owner-occupants. We underwrite the deal, the property value, the after-repair value (ARV), and the investor's plan — not personal income or tax returns.

    vs. a conventional mortgage

    Conventional mortgages require income verification, debt-to-income calculations, and underwriting timelines measured in weeks. Fix and flip loans are asset-based, close in days, and are structured around the project timeline — not a 30-year repayment schedule.

    vs. a bridge loan

    A bridge loan gets you from one deal to the next; it's not built to fund a rehab. Fix and flip loans are structured to fund both the purchase and the construction draw schedule in one loan. See We Lend's Bridge Loans page →

    vs. a DSCR loan

    DSCR loans are priced on a rental property's income coverage ratio, designed for investors who plan to hold. Fix and flip loans are priced on the resale exit. If you're deciding between a flip and a hold, that distinction changes the loan structure, the rate, and the timeline. Read more about DSCR loans →

    Asset-Based

    Underwritten on the property, the ARV, and the plan — not W-2 income or tax returns.

    Short-Term

    Built around your project timeline — 12 months standard, repaid at resale.

    Purchase + Rehab

    Acquisition price and full rehab budget funded in a single loan structure.

    What we fund

    Purchase price + full rehab. One loan.

    A lender who won't cover the full rehab leaves you short at the worst possible time. Lenders who fund purchase-only, or who cap rehab coverage at a fraction of the project budget, create a financing gap that the borrower has to bridge out of pocket or through a secondary instrument. We Lend does not do that.

    Rehab funds are held in reserve and drawn down as work is completed. Draws are inspected and released on a defined schedule, so the project stays funded at every stage — not just at closing.

    100% of the rehab budget is funded.
    No financing gap between what you borrow and what the project costs.

    Eligibility

    Built for active real estate investors

    The file review focuses on the deal — the property, the purchase price, the rehab scope, and the ARV. No W-2 income documentation or debt-to-income calculations required.

    Property types
    Single-family residences, 2–4 unit properties, condominiums, townhomes, mixed-use, and small multifamily.
    Credit
    Asset-based underwriting; no stated minimum credit score. Strong deals from borrowers with lighter credit history are reviewed on deal merit.
    Experience
    Experienced investors with documented exits receive the strongest terms. First-time flippers with a well-structured deal and a viable rehab plan are reviewed on a deal-by-deal basis. No minimum flip count for application.
